You know, Lexxy, you can reinstall at any time any of the Big Fish games you buy. And, you don't have to burn the game to a disc in order to replay it.

Just go to My Account then Purchases in BF, and you'll see a listing of what you've purchased along with an install button. Actually, what I do is print out the list and make notes about each game so I know whether or not I'd like to replay it....or whether my husband would enjoy it. Works great.
